About The School
Kwara State Polytechnic, Ilorin, is a renowned institution of higher learning located in Ilorin, Kwara State, Nigeria. Established in 1973, the polytechnic has a rich history of academic excellence and innovation.
Kwara State Polytechnic offers a range of programs, including National Diploma (ND) and Higher National Diploma (HND) courses in fields such as engineering, science, technology, arts, and management. With a strong focus on practical skills and hands-on training, the polytechnic equips students with the knowledge and expertise needed to succeed in their chosen careers.
The polytechnic has a vibrant campus life, with various student organizations and clubs catering to different interests and hobbies. Kwara State Polytechnic also provides support services, including counseling, career guidance, and internship opportunities, to help students achieve their academic and personal goals.

FAQs
What is the polytechnic’s admission requirement?
The polytechnic’s admission requirement includes a minimum of five credit passes in relevant subjects, including English Language and Mathematics, in the Senior Secondary Certificate Examination (SSCE) or its equivalent.
What is the duration of the programs at Kwara State Polytechnic?
The duration of the programs varies, with National Diploma (ND) programs typically lasting two years and Higher National Diploma (HND) programs lasting two years as well.
Are the programs offered at Kwara State Polytechnic accredited?
Yes, the programs offered at the polytechnic are accredited by the National Board for Technical Education (NBTE) and other relevant professional bodies.
